Exposition : Sur les chemins de l'Aquarelle
Landscapes from scenes of life
Exhibition by Evelyne Leroy
"Sur les chemins de l'aquarelle" features a series of watercolors inspired by the seaside, an exploration of its peaceful, ever-changing landscapes.
This exhibition invites us to take a soothing stroll, where we can lose ourselves in the softness of seascapes and escape into Nepalese panoramas. A true dialogue between art and travel, contemplation and creation, where each canvas invites us to slow down and appreciate the beauty of the moment.

Evelyne Leroy has always had a pencil in her hand and colors in her heart, and knew she was made for watercolor from the very first time she met her. This demanding yet free technique has guided her towards an art of calm, reflection and precision, while enabling her to convey her personal vision of the world.
This complicity between water and color gave rise to an ongoing quest for light and transparency on paper. One day, her hands met clay, and a new passion came to enrich her universe: sculpture from live models, where the gaze and gesture capture life in motion.
